g5k-api merge requestshtt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ests2020-09-01T15:45:10+02:00https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/72WIP: Return a global view of reference-repository2020-09-01T15:45:10+02:00Samir NoirWIP: Return a global view of reference-repositoryhtt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/71WIP: Fix map and historical visualizations pages2020-09-08T17:16:38+02:00Samir NoirWIP: Fix map and historical visualizations pageshtt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/70WIP: Return a global view of reference-repository2020-09-01T15:39:33+02:00Samir NoirWIP: Return a global view of reference-repositoryhtt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/68[g5k-api] Use hostname -f in config files2020-08-13T09:25:51+02:00BERARD Benjamin[g5k-api] Use hostname -f in config fileshtt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/64[gitlab-ci] add sonarqube and rubocop2020-08-24T10:49:07+02:00DELABROYE Dimitri[gitlab-ci] add sonarqube and rubocopajoute l'analyse par sonar-scanner sur la branche masterajoute l'analyse par sonar-scanner sur la branche masterSamir NoirSamir Noirhtt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/60WIP: Change the email sender2020-03-17T11:40:38+01:00Nicolas PerrinWIP: Change the email senderhtt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/33Fix for disk reservation (bug 7929)2017-04-03T11:40:33+02:00MARGERY DavidFix for disk reservation (bug 7929)*Created by: f-didier*
*Created by: f-didier*
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/31Single commit for bug #7360 - added option job-key-from-file2017-07-18T13:54:48+02:00MARGERY DavidSingle commit for bug #7360 - added option job-key-from-file*Created by: nirvanesque*
- Single commit for bug #7360 - added option job-key-from-file as variable job_key_from_file + spec test
- other textual changes are cosmetic*Created by: nirvanesque*
- Single commit for bug #7360 - added option job-key-from-file as variable job_key_from_file + spec test
- other textual changes are cosmetichttps://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/25Bugs/#5856 - Cleared accidental remove of sites/nancy/clusters/2016-10-25T10:13:11+02:00MARGERY DavidBugs/#5856 - Cleared accidental remove of sites/nancy/clusters/*Created by: nirvanesque*
Cleared accidental remove of sites/nancy/clusters/ in bug/#5856
*Created by: nirvanesque*
Cleared accidental remove of sites/nancy/clusters/ in bug/#5856
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/23Bugs/#7301 - to expose /servers on each site2016-10-24T16:52:03+02:00MARGERY DavidBugs/#7301 - to expose /servers on each site*Created by: nirvanesque*
Added /servers with 2 servers in site nancy + cleared git remove for /clusters in nancy - accidentally made in earlier commit.
*Created by: nirvanesque*
Added /servers with 2 servers in site nancy + cleared git remove for /clusters in nancy - accidentally made in earlier commit.
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/21Fix Grid'5000 bug #6693 by adding em-postgresql-adapter gem2016-03-16T16:18:15+01:00MARGERY DavidFix Grid'5000 bug #6693 by adding em-postgresql-adapter gem*Created by: clement-parisot*
See Bugs/#6693 on Grid5000:
API-Devel servers are down.
In the thin.log:
```
/op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activerecord-3.0.10/lib/active_record/connection_adapters/abstract/connection_...*Created by: clement-parisot*
See Bugs/#6693 on Grid5000:
API-Devel servers are down.
In the thin.log:
```
/op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activerecord-3.0.10/lib/active_record/connection_adapters/abstract/connection_specification.rb:71:in `rescue in establish_connection': Please install the em_postgresql adapter: `gem install
activerecord-em_postgresql-adapter` (no such file to load -- active_record/connection_adapters/em_postgresql_adapter) (RuntimeError)
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activerecord-3.0.10/lib/active_record/connection_adapters/abstract/connection_specification.rb:68:in `establish_connection'
from /opt/local/g5k-api/config/initializers/oar.rb:17:in `<top (required)>'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activesupport-3.0.10/lib/active_support/dependencies.rb:235:in `load'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activesupport-3.0.10/lib/active_support/dependencies.rb:235:in `block in load'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activesupport-3.0.10/lib/active_support/dependencies.rb:227:in `load_dependency'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/activesupport-3.0.10/lib/active_support/dependencies.rb:235:in `load'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/engine.rb:201:in `block (2 levels) in <class:Engine>'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/engine.rb:200:in `each'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/engine.rb:200:in `block in <class:Engine>'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/initializable.rb:25:in `instance_exec'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/initializable.rb:25:in `run'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/initializable.rb:50:in `block in run_initializers'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/initializable.rb:49:in `each'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/initializable.rb:49:in `run_initializers'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/application.rb:134:in `initialize!'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/railties-3.0.10/lib/rails/application.rb:77:in `method_missing'
from /opt/local/g5k-api/config/environment.rb:20:in `<top (required)>'
from /opt/local/g5k-api/config.ru:3:in `require'
from /opt/local/g5k-api/config.ru:3:in `block in <main>'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/rack-1.2.4/lib/rack/builder.rb:46:in `instance_eval'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/rack-1.2.4/lib/rack/builder.rb:46:in `initialize'
from /opt/local/g5k-api/config.ru:1:in `new'
from /opt/local/g5k-api/config.ru:1:in `<main>'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/rack/adapter/loader.rb:36:in `eval'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/rack/adapter/loader.rb:36:in `load'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/thin/controllers/controller.rb:181:in `load_rackup_config'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/thin/controllers/controller.rb:71:in `start'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/thin/runner.rb:185:in `run_command'
from /opt/local/g5k-api/vendor/bundle/ruby/1.9.1/gems/thin-1.2.11/lib/thin/runner.rb:151:in `run!'
from /opt/local/g5k-api/bin/g5k-api.rb:32:in `<top (required)>'
from <internal:lib/rubygems/custom_require>:29:in `require'
from <internal:lib/rubygems/custom_require>:29:in `require'
from /usr/bin/g5k-api:2:in `<main>'
```
In Gemfile of g5k-api I find this commented line.
```
#gem 'em-postgresql-adapter', :git => 'git://github.com/leftbee/em-postgresql-adapter.git', :branch => 'pre-3_1'
```
Maybe need to be uncommented ?
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/24Bugs/#5856 - Cleared accidental remove of sites/nancy/clusters/2016-10-25T10:13:11+02:00MARGERY DavidBugs/#5856 - Cleared accidental remove of sites/nancy/clusters/*Created by: nirvanesque*
Cleared accidental remove of sites/nancy/clusters/ in bug/#5856
*Created by: nirvanesque*
Cleared accidental remove of sites/nancy/clusters/ in bug/#5856
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/18Bugs/#63632016-02-17T16:49:22+01:00MARGERY DavidBugs/#6363*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/19Bugs/#63632016-02-17T17:00:34+01:00MARGERY DavidBugs/#6363*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/17Bugs/#63632016-02-17T16:47:25+01:00MARGERY DavidBugs/#6363*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
*Created by: nirvanesque*
second correction to bug #6363 but without spec tests
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/5Corrections ONLY for bug ref 5694 including spec unit tests2015-03-13T16:15:19+01:00MARGERY DavidCorrections ONLY for bug ref 5694 including spec unit tests*Created by: nirvanesque*
Hello,
Please verify and accept pull request from the following commit:
"updated with corrections ONLY for bug ref 5694 including spec unit tests"
Thanks in advance,
Anirvan
*Created by: nirvanesque*
Hello,
Please verify and accept pull request from the following commit:
"updated with corrections ONLY for bug ref 5694 including spec unit tests"
Thanks in advance,
Anirvan
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/6Corrections ONLY for bug ref 5694 including spec unit tests2015-03-20T09:28:39+01:00MARGERY DavidCorrections ONLY for bug ref 5694 including spec unit tests*Created by: nirvanesque*
Hello,
Please verify and accept my bug fix proposal for ref 5694
Thanks in advance,
Anirvan
*Created by: nirvanesque*
Hello,
Please verify and accept my bug fix proposal for ref 5694
Thanks in advance,
Anirvan
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/4Corrections for bug ref 5694 including spec unit tests2015-03-13T12:28:19+01:00MARGERY DavidCorrections for bug ref 5694 including spec unit tests*Created by: nirvanesque*
Hello,
Please verify and accept bug fix proposition.
Thanks in advance,
Anirvan
*Created by: nirvanesque*
Hello,
Please verify and accept bug fix proposition.
Thanks in advance,
Anirvan
https://gitlab.inria.fr/grid5000/g5k-api/-/merge_requests/1Fixes for bugs 5347, 5065, 5694, 5106 by Anirvan BASU2015-03-10T14:44:33+01:00MARGERY DavidFixes for bugs 5347, 5065, 5694, 5106 by Anirvan BASU*Created by: nirvanesque*
Bonjour David et Simon,
Tout d'abord mes excuses d'avoir créé ce fork sur g5k-api
La raison principale est : je n'ai pas d'accès sur grid5000/g5k-api pour faire push et commit.
J'avais oublié vous démander l...*Created by: nirvanesque*
Bonjour David et Simon,
Tout d'abord mes excuses d'avoir créé ce fork sur g5k-api
La raison principale est : je n'ai pas d'accès sur grid5000/g5k-api pour faire push et commit.
J'avais oublié vous démander l'accès avant vos départs en congés (et je pars en congés la semaine prochaine, quand vous seriez de retour).
Ici dans ce pull request sont présentes les corrections aux bugs suivants :
Réferences sur https://intranet.grid5000.fr/bugzilla/ : 5347, 5065, 5694, 5106
3 fichiers ont été modifiés, comme suivants
config/routes.rb
lib/oar/job.rb
lib/oar/resource.rb
dont les corrections, David est bien au courant.
Il n'y a que une seule branche avec toutes mes corrections (cf. réponse email de Simon au 26/01)
Je vois que personne avant moi avait fait un fork, et je m'inquiète de ne pas avoir pris la correcte décision.
J'ai discuté avec Marc et Pascal pour m'en rassurer avant de procéder.
Néanmoins, si vous préfériez autrement, je pourrais supprimer mon fork et avec accès donné, je pourrai faire un commit normal vers grid5000:g5k-api
Je pourrai le faire pendant mon congé et je reste à votre disposition par email, pendant mes vacances.
Bien à vous,
Anirvan